The Bachelor of Science in Computer Science is accredited by the Computing Accreditation Commission of ABET, . The B.S. program provides majors with a sound educational base. The Master of Science prepares students for research, teaching, or further study towards the Ph.D. in Computer Science or Software Engineering. (Currently the Ph.D. is offered by the University of California in various locations and some private institutions such as Stanford University.) Our programs also enable individuals with background in other areas to obtain the skills and knowledge necessary to enter and/or advance in employment in computer-related industries.

The student must find a faculty member who is willing to work with the student and supervise the thesis or project. The advisor and the student should formulate a plan for the work to be done. A Master's Project can consist of a high-quality paper or piece of software.

Computer science touches almost all aspects of our daily lives. It is the basis of many of the endeavors in society today and continues to advance various areas and open new fields, among them the entertainment industry, engineering, government, medicine, manufacturing, science, space exploration and communication. From its theoretical and algorithmic foundations to cutting-edge developments in robotics, computer vision, intelligent systems, bioinformatics and other exciting areas, a comprehensive foundation in computer science allows graduates to adapt to new technologies and new ideas.

Accredited by the Commission on Colleges of the Southern Association of College and Schools.

Major Research Areas:
An excellent selection of courses and laboratories support graduate studies in algorithms, artificial intelligence,
machine learning, data mining, computer architecture, graphics, networks, computer vision, distributed systems,
embedded systems, expert systems, formal verification, image processing, pattern recognition, robotics, databases,
software engineering, computer security, compilers, programming languages, and VLSI design and CAD.

The Department offers the Bachelor of Science and Master of Science in in conjunction with the Electrical and Electronic Engineering Department.

The thesis option requires the completion of 24 credit hours of CSE graduate‐level courses (9 credit hours of core courses
and 15 hours of electives) and 6 credit hours of thesis in computer science related problems, as determined by the Major
Professor and documented in the Plan of Work. At least 16 credit hours must be at the 6000 level. With prior permission
from the Graduate Program Director, students can take a maximum of 3 hours of Independent Study or Internship, a
maximum of 3 hours of one‐hour seminar courses, and up to one graduate level course (3 credit hours) outside of the

The breadth of subjects which are part of computer science together with the immense diversity of its applications,
make it imperative that students in the Master's program maintain close contact with the Graduate Program Director,
or, if choosing the thesis option, with their major professor in order to achieve a coherent plan of study directed
towards a specific goal. In particular, election of courses should only be made with prior consultation and approval of
the Major Professor or the Graduate Program Director.